Transaction e4b24169734b699776dd12a9f9e7e05125ff2c74beb1e4d58e80a387752115a7
1 Input
1 Output
-
e4b24169734b699776dd12a9f9e7e05125ff2c74beb1e4d58e80a387752115a7:0
- value
- 3554602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f886fd43ba79939e77f1f197a620dacd5591c1f2 OP_EQUAL
- address
- 3QM7DLf3bvRFh5QwSDBjUrQgA6U6Ju8hoX